We’re seeking a future team member for the role of Vice President, Information Security to join our Engineering team. This role is located in Sydney – HYBRID.

Job Purpose:

As a Senior Cyber Threat Analyst, you will be given the opportunity to join a team of security analysts about both traditional and unconventional ways to detect, analyze, and mitigate potential intrusions and other security incidents. The candidate will join a follow the sun team currently responsible for providing investigative response for security events including but not limited to intrusion detection, malware infections, denial of service attacks, privileged account misuse and network breaches.

Candidates must be willing to work in a SOC environment, demonstrate strong problem solving skills, have demonstrable experience in various toolsets and best practices, able to critically think, and allow for flexible scheduling. 

In this role, you’ll make an impact in the following ways: 

  • Collects, analyzes, and enriches event information and perform threat or target analysis duties.
  • Interprets, analyzes, and reports all events and anomalies in accordance with Computer Network Directives, including initiating, responding, and reporting discovered events.
  • Manages and executes multi-level responses and addresses reported or detected incidents.
  • Providing reporting and metrics around security monitoring by designing dashboards for asset owners and management consumption.
  • Coordinates and distributes directives, vulnerability, and threat advisories to identified consumers.
  • Develops focused reporting and briefings for advanced cyber threats and activity to various teams and leaders.
  • Provides correlation and trending of Program’s cyber incident activity.
  • Create AARs and document TTPs, with the ability to do deep dive investigations on complex incidents.
  • Improve the service level for security operations and monitoring. Creating and maintaining system documentation for security event processing.
  • Author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and training documentation.
  • Act a SME and trainer to T2 and T1 personal as needed.

To be successful in this role, we’re seeking the following: 

  • Candidates must be willing to work 1 weekend shift as part of their normal work week
  • Bachelor's Degree in a technical discipline with a minimum of 8 years related technical experience is required for a senior role. An additional 2 years of experience may be substituted in lieu of a degree or relevant professional certifications
  • Must have at least two (2) certifications, from a respectable security organization (e.g. based on U.S. DOD8570 standard)
  • Background in hands on computer and networking experience to include an understanding of TCP/IP, routing, and major Internet protocols.
  • Understanding of network, desktop and server technologies, including experience with network intrusion methods, network containment, segregation techniques and technologies such as Intrusion Detection Systems (IDS) and Intrusion Protection Systems (IPS).
  • 5 years Intrusion monitoring, incident response and mitigation, web application security, threat research, pen testing or intelligence analysis.
  • Ability to read and write scripts in various languages. (php, ksh, python, powershell, SQL, and or similar)
  • 5 years using Splunk, ArcSight and/or similar SIEM experience.
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ills, including the ability to provide technical thought leadership on security incident investigation calls with other technology teams, and the ability to translate complex technical concepts into plain English for consumption by non-technical audiences.
  • Ability to thrive in ambiguity on situations and have attention to detail.
  • Self-motivated and able to work in an independent manner.
  • Experience and proficiency in various security tool sets (including BNYM’s existing tool sets) and best practices an added advantage
